Why play it

Begin your journey as Rick Grimes, waking alone in a hospital surrounded by the dead. Assemble allies and fight your way through the walker apocalypse across iconic locations from The Walking Dead, including Atlanta, the Greene family farm, the prison, and Woodbury. In crucial choice-driven moments, you’ll forever shape the destiny of your team of characters from the series. Heroes and villains, living and dead – it’s up to you to decide whether to stay the course of history or forge your own path through the world of AMC’s The Walking Dead.

Nintendo LifeOliver Reynolds · 23 Nov, 2023
2/10

Publisher GameMill should be embarrassed at putting out The Walking Dead: Destinies at any price, let alone as a $50 boxed product, and we sincerely hope AMC Networks takes a bit more care in who it entrusts with its IP in the future. There's absolutely nothing here that has been executed well; it's a game that is simply rife with technical blunders, terrible production values, and broken mechanics. The only thing keeping Destinies from achieving a lower score is that you can at least play to the end credits, but even those have been fumbled. In a year filled with bonafide classics, Destinies is the worst game we've played.

neXGamMichael Tausendpfund · 12 Jan, 2024

Objectively speaking, The Walking Dead – Destinies is truly awful: mercilessly outdated technology, clunky animations, and gameplay mechanics that don't quite work as intended. Nevertheless, the game somehow managed to motivate me to play through to the end. Perhaps it's the same phenomenon I had with Escape From Bug Island on the Wii. Back then, the trashiness of the story kept me entertained, even though the game itself wasn't that great. Here, it's probably the similarity to the series that appealed to me. Although the choices you make do allow you to influence the course of the story to a certain extent. However, if you're not a die-hard fan of the series, I'd advise you to try it out first. Because I can't really recommend this title to anyone.

COGconnectedJaz Sagoo · 21 Nov, 2023
5/10

The Walking Dead: Destinies would have been a fitting release a decade ago during the peak of the series’ popularity, ironically, the game plays as if it belongs to that era too. You’ll quickly tire of the repetitive mission structure and grow frustrated with the combat system. Although the game claims to allow you to choose the path that Rick and Co. walk, your decisions barely make a difference. Even die-hard fans of the formidable franchise will want to steer clear of this undead adventure due to its dated design and poor execution.

GamingBoltShubhankar Parijat · 21 Nov, 2023
2/10

It wouldn't surprise me if someone told me The Walking Dead: Destinies was put together in a matter of weeks. Nothing about this game works, and every inch of it is weighed down by significant issues. It's incredibly barebones and shallow, which is made worse by the fact that even in the execution of its utterly straightforward and simplistic ideas, it fails in spectacular fashion. Worst of all, it does absolutely nothing with its intriguing central hook. This may very well be the worst game of 2023.
